The AMD RX 6900 XT wins in 10 out of 13 comparable specs, with 1 tie. Its biggest advantage is FP32 Performance (324% better).
GTX 1660 Ti wins in 2 specs (MSRP: 72% better).
Recommendation
Choose RX 6900 XT if you want the best overall performance — especially fp32 performance.
Choose GTX 1660 Ti if msrp matters more to you.
